Placental abruption occurs when the placenta detaches from the uterine wall before delivery, leading to severe complications. This condition is relatively rare, affecting approximately 1% of pregnancies, but its consequences can be life-threatening. The detachment of the placenta can result in heavy vaginal bleeding, which, if not promptly controlled, can lead to hemorrhagic shock, a condition characterized by a severe drop in blood pressure and organ failure.
The severity of placental abruption varies depending on the extent of detachment. In some cases, the separation may be partial, allowing for some blood flow to the baby. However, in complete abruptions, where the placenta separates entirely from the uterus, the baby is deprived of oxygen and nutrients, further complicating the situation. This lack of blood supply can lead to fetal distress and even fetal demise.
While the primary focus is often on the baby's well-being, it is crucial to recognize the potential dangers placental abruption poses to the mother. Maternal mortality rates associated with placental abruption vary depending on several factors, including the timing of diagnosis, the extent of detachment, and the availability of prompt medical intervention. However, studies have shown that maternal deaths can occur in severe cases, especially if timely and appropriate management is not provided.
One of the major risks for the mother in cases of placental abruption is hemorrhage. The detachment of the placenta can cause significant bleeding, leading to hypovolemic shock, a condition where the body loses too much blood to function properly. If not promptly treated, this can result in organ failure and ultimately lead to maternal death. In addition to hemorrhage, placental abruption can also cause disseminated intravascular coagulation (DIC), a condition characterized by abnormal blood clotting that can further exacerbate bleeding and increase the risk of mortality.
The prompt diagnosis and management of placental abruption are vital in preventing maternal mortality. Healthcare providers must be vigilant in recognizing the signs and symptoms of this condition, such as vaginal bleeding, abdominal pain, and uterine contractions. Once diagnosed, immediate medical intervention is necessary to control bleeding, stabilize the mother's condition, and ensure the best possible outcome.
Treatment for placental abruption often involves a combination of interventions, including blood transfusions, fluid resuscitation, and, in severe cases, emergency delivery of the baby. In some instances, a cesarean section may be necessary to expedite delivery and prevent further complications. Close monitoring of the mother's vital signs and continuous assessment of fetal well-being are essential throughout the management process.
